US to End Temporary Protected Status for Cameroonians

Cameroon's Temporary Protected Status (TPS) will end on August 4, 2025, after which holders will lose their protected status and work permits. It is advised to seek legal assistance to explore asylum or other immigration options to address potential risks of undocumented status.

US Extends Temporary Protected Status for Eligible Immigrants

Temporary Protected Status (TPS) provides legal protection to individuals unable to return to their home countries due to crises, allowing them to legally reside and work in the United States. Holders of El Salvador TPS must re-register by March 18, 2025, to continue enjoying their rights.

US TPS Program Expands Opportunities for Ethiopian Immigrants

The Temporary Protected Status (TPS) in the United States provides legal protection for Ethiopian immigrants, allowing them to legally stay in the U.S. and apply for work permits. Applicants must meet specific criteria, with a deadline set for December 12, 2025.
